Output b379505a42e64d1b21e93639ecdb17c6340114896bff9212ccb5a5916dec0324:22

value
25845
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43193c754f885c724cbdf61dd47b005646eb3dce250bb6a03ce8474a95d6c409
address
bc1pgvvnca203pw8yn9a7cwag7cq2erwk0wwy59mdgpuapr549wkcsysgeaqzx
transaction
b379505a42e64d1b21e93639ecdb17c6340114896bff9212ccb5a5916dec0324
confirmations
104974
spent
true